Update! I took it for its MOT this afternoon and it passed with no advisories Chuffed!

With that out the way I thought I better crack on with the engine paintwork! So within about an hour of its mot it looked like this -







Removed all the radiator etc too ready for the TX autosport alloy rad

The main area I'm doing is the slam panel but im also respraying the D/S chassis leg as well. Its been bugging me for a while as rust was starting in places and it had also got scratched a bit when I did my head rebuild. So this is how it started



The first thing I did was to wire wheel the rusty areas to get them back to bare metal





Then I prepped the rest of the panel

]



Engine bays gonna need one hell of a clean after all this

The bare metal de rusted bits were then treated with Bilt Hamber Deox gel



Wrapped in cling film to stop it drying out overnight



Primer tomorrow!

Thanks everyone

Started work nice and early this morning because I had to go into work in the afternoon. The first thing I did was to see how the Deox gel had got on after being left overnight





Did its job nicely! Gave the panel a good clean with some soapy water to remove the gel and was left with this



Nice clean bare metal! So I brought the car into the garage and got it masked up



After a good clean with some wax and grease remover I gave it 3 coats on zinc primer on the bare metal patches, then 3 coats of high build primer followed by a guide coat for when I flatten it back



The plan for tomorrow is to get the chassis leg primed and get the slam panel flattened back and painted!

Paul you really cant go wrong with Bilt Hambers rust remover products mate. They are awesome! I've been using their Deox-C rust remover bath as well to do some nuts and bolts while its apart and they have come up like brand new!
